  • Abstract
    We illustrate a novel design methodology for the stabilization of power converters with constant-power loads by passive damping. In our formulation of the problem we allow the destabilizing loads to be modeled by by frequency-dependent negative impedances. Our methodology is based on the solution of bilinear- and linear matrix inequalities, for which standard numerical solvers can be used.
